#796082 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#796082 is composed of 47.5% red, 37.6%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.9% cyan, 26.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 284.1 degrees, a saturation of 15% and a lightness of 44.3%. #796082 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2c0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#796082 color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#796082 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#796082 has RGB values of R:121, G:96,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7954562.
